Total cost to purchase

Purchase Price
$1,100,000
Stamp Duty (Queensland)
$43,775
Transfer/Registration Fee
$4,532
Mortgage Registration (est., if financed)
$200
Legal & Conveyancing (est.)
$2,000
Building & Pest Inspection (est.)
$700
Rates & Water Adjustment at Settlement (est.)
$800
Total cash required
$1,152,007

$52,007 on top of the price (4.7% extra)

  • Stamp Duty (Queensland)
  • Transfer/Registration Fee
  • Mortgage Registration
  • Legal & Conveyancing
  • Building & Pest Inspection
  • Rates & Water Adjustment

Estimates only, at standard investor rates — no first-home or owner-occupier concessions applied. Not included: lenders mortgage insurance (usually applies when borrowing more than 80% of the price), loan application and settlement fees from your lender, the foreign-purchaser duty surcharge, and building insurance — in Queensland the property is at your risk from the first business day after signing, not from settlement. Verify with your conveyancer.

Stamp duty and transfer fees: Queensland schedules from 2026-07-01. Ongoing council rates and land tax are not included.

Where Style, Space and Comfort Come Together!

Nestled in a quiet, family-friendly pocket and only moments from local parks and open green space, this beautifully presented home delivers an exceptional lifestyle defined by comfort, quality and effortless living. Thoughtfully built, the well-considered floorplan offers a seamless balance of space, style and functionality, creating a home perfectly suited to modern family life.

Designed for both everyday living and entertaining, the heart of the home is the impressive kitchen. Complete with stone benchtops, pendant lighting, a walk-in pantry, double bowl sink and a 900mm gas cooktop and oven, this space is as practical as it is stylish. Overlooking the expansive open plan living and dining zone, the kitchen flows effortlessly to the oversized covered alfresco, creating a seamless indoor-outdoor connection.

Stepping outside, you'll find a private backyard oasis featuring a sparkling in-ground concrete pool, offering the perfect setting to relax, entertain or enjoy time with family and friends. Adding further versatility, a separate media room positioned at the front of the home provides an additional living space ideal for movie nights, a children's retreat or a home office.

Read the full description

The spacious master suite is privately positioned and serves as a peaceful retreat, complete with a walk-in robe and beautifully appointed ensuite. The remaining three bedrooms are generously sized and include built-in robes and ceiling fans, ensuring comfort for the whole family. The main bathroom is thoughtfully designed with both a separate shower and bathtub to suit busy family living.

Set on a fully fenced 480m² block with potential side access, the property offers plenty of space for children and pets to enjoy, along with room for additional storage if desired.

Constructed with a durable steel frame and finished with quality inclusions throughout, this home also features ducted air-conditioning, 9-foot ceilings, plantation shutters, a solar system and a double remote-controlled garage. This exceptional residence offers the complete package for families seeking style, space and convenience in a highly sought-after location.
